Kenya's taxes on international trade (% of revenue) was 8.0% in 2023, ranking #41 out of 116 countries. This represents a +3.6% change from 2022. Over the past 9 years, the highest recorded value was 8.3% (2021) and the lowest was 6.3% (2017). Data sourced from the World Bank World Development Indicators.
